Common Traditional Styles I Look For

When I explore traditional Puerto Rican clothing, I often see styles inspired by jíbaro and folkloric attire. For men, I may look for embroidered shirts, wide-brim hats, and simple yet elegant outfits that reflect rural heritage. For women, I notice colorful dresses, full skirts, lace details, and traditional blouses that are often worn during dances and festivals. I always try to choose styles that match the occasion and honor the cultural roots behind them.

Fabric and Comfort Matter to Me

I pay close attention to fabric because Puerto Rico’s warm climate makes breathability important. Cotton and lightweight blends are often my first choice because they feel comfortable and allow movement. If I’m buying clothing for performance or special events, I also look for materials that hold their shape well and don’t wrinkle too easily. Comfort is important to me because traditional clothing should look beautiful without feeling restrictive.
